Taysha Gene Therapies, Inc. (NASDAQ:TSHA) is one of the 10 Best Small-Cap Biotech Stocks According to Hedge Funds. The stock is up 343.45% from its price a year ago and 22.48% year-to-date. On April 15, Needham reiterated its buy rating for Taysha Gene Therapies with a price target of $12.
Earlier on April 6, Canaccord Genuity also reiterated its buy rating for Taysha Gene Therapies, raising its price target to $17 from $14.
On April 3, Taysha Gene Therapies announced that the Compensation Committee of its Board of Directors granted four new employees, in the aggregate, restricted stock units (RSUs) representing 300,000 shares of the company’s common stock and an option to purchase 92,400 shares of the company’s common stock in connection with their employment. The RSUs and stock options were granted under the Taysha Gene Therapies, Inc. 2023 Inducement Plan as an inducement material to the individuals entering employment with Taysha in accordance with Nasdaq Listing Rule 5635(c)(4).
Taysha Gene Therapies (NASDAQ:TSHA) is a clinical-stage biotechnology company focused on advancing adeno-associated virus (AAV)-based gene therapies for severe monogenic diseases of the central nervous system. Its lead clinical program, TSHA-102, is in development for Rett syndrome, a rare neurodevelopmental disorder with no approved disease-modifying therapies that address the genetic root cause of the disease.

"TSHA's current valuation is purely speculative and entirely dependent on the successful clinical execution of the TSHA-102 program, leaving it highly vulnerable to binary trial results."
The 343% surge in TSHA is a classic 'hope-trade' driven by clinical-stage excitement rather than fundamental earnings. While the $17 price target from Canaccord signals confidence in TSHA-102 for Rett syndrome, investors must recognize that Taysha is burning cash aggressively to fund these AAV-based gene therapy trials. The recent inducement grants for new hires suggest a company scaling up operations, which is a positive signal for execution, but dilution remains a constant shadow for retail holders. With no commercialized product, the valuation is entirely tethered to clinical milestones. If the upcoming data readouts for TSHA-102 miss efficacy endpoints, the stock lacks a fundamental floor to prevent a rapid retracement.
The massive year-over-year gains may have already priced in the best-case clinical outcomes, leaving little margin for error in a high-interest-rate environment that punishes capital-intensive biotech.
